doc/api.txt: Merge with api-funcs.txt
It's important that users have a single, easy-to-remember place for reading about the API. So this commit changes gen_api_vimdoc.py so that the generated section is appended to api.txt instead of creating a separate document. Also remove the section numbering and ToC: it's a maintenance cost, and it will be unnecessary when #5169 is integrated.
